Netflix just announced that The Witcher universe is expanding with the limited series "The Witcher: Blood Origin". "Blood Origin" will be a six part, live-action limited series, and a prequel to the well-received and well-loved Netflix series "The Witcher" which released late 2019. The series will be set in an elven world 1200 years before the timeline of "The Witcher" and will tell a story lost to time - the origin of the very first Witcher, and the events that lead to the pivotal “conjunction of the spheres” - or when the worlds of monsters, men, and elves merged to become one. As of today, no details yet on the cast or a release date but the series will be shot in and around the UK and will be produced by showrunner Declan de Barra and Lauren Schmidt Hissrich.
